The Boring Company: Tunneling Towards a Future for Autonomous Vehicles?
Elon Musk's The Boring Company is making headlines for its ambitious vision of revolutionizing urban transportation. Focusing on subterranean tunnels as the solution to traffic congestion, they aim to create a high-speed network for autonomous vehicles to navigate seamlessly below ground. While their initial focus was on utility transport, the company has recently hinted at integrating self-driving cars into their interconnected tunnel systems. This move could potentially reshape the landscape of personal transportation, offering a safer alternative to traditional roads.
- The Boring Company's tunnels utilize advanced boring machines and construction techniques to create smooth, wide-diameter passages.
- However, critics raise concerns about the sustainability of such a large-scale infrastructure project.
- The cost of construction, potential environmental impacts, and the need for regulatory approvals remain significant challenges to overcome.
Still, The Boring Company's innovative approach has sparked considerable interest and debate within the transportation industry. Whether their vision will become a reality remains to be seen, but it's undeniable that they are pushing the boundaries of what's possible in urban mobility.
